The Gaia hypothesis is a scientific concept proposing that the Earth's biosphere (living organisms) and its physical components (atmosphere, oceans, land) interact to form a complex, self-regulating system that maintains the conditions for life on the planet.
Proposed by James Lovelock, this hypothesis views the Earth not just as a collection of interacting parts, but as a single, integrated system akin to a living organism. This "organism" actively adjusts its internal processes to maintain stability, such as regulating temperature and atmospheric composition.
